Low-Fodmap Cobb Salad & Ranch Dressing

For this salad, I purchase Applegate brand deli ham because it is casein, dairy, gluten, and nitrate free and has no hidden spices that are high in fodmaps. I also buy bacon from the local butcher shop because it is fresh, thick, and awesome.

I use Green Valley Organics Lactose-free Yogurt as the base for this dressing. I don’t have exact measurements for the dressing because I usually taste as I go and add more or less depending on my mood. In other words, it’s versatile and can adjust to your liking!

Ingredients

  • Large bowl of mixed salad greens
  •  3 hardboiled eggs, sliced
  • 3-4 slices of deli ham, roughly chopped
  • 4 pieces of bacon, crumbled
  • cherry tomatoes, halved
  • 1 cucumber, diced
  • 1 avocado, diced (omit for low-fodmap)
  • cheddar cheese, shredded

Ranch Dressing

  • 6 oz. lactose-free plain yogurt
  • ground black pepper, to taste
  • sea salt, to taste
  • parsley, to taste
  • 1 tsp dill weed (this makes the dressing!)
  • stone ground mustard
  • lemon juice

Directions

Place yogurt, pepper, salt, parsley and dill into a food processor and pulse until blended. Add and blend lemon juice and mustard a little at a time and taste as you go. Adjust spices as needed. Refrigerate until ready to serve.

Combine mixed greens, tomatoes, and cucumbers into a bowl. Top with bacon, egg, ham, avocado and cheese. Drizzle with dressing and enjoy!

*the dressing in this recipe was adapted to fit the low-fodmap diet
